Engineers apply software to develop systems that happen to be user-friendly, own specific uses and work well with other technology. They can design and style, develop and support applications that are used in phones, notebook computers, computers and cars, among other things. It’s important to get engineering clubs to develop a strategy for code and making certain their operate is reusable and supportable. This can be done by establishing standards for identifying conventions and proof as well as making a process designed for removing dead code right from pipelines.
Data is becoming more and more valuable to companies and being used around more business functions. Companies are using it to predict the future, style customers, stop threats and in many cases create new kinds of items. However , leveraging this information can require significant data facilities and specialized tools. Data technological innovation teams are in charge of for making this kind of data usable.
They assist data experts choose engineering for studying to comprehend the specific requirements of a job and then build data pipelines that source and transform this data in the structures needed for analysis. Additionally they use monitoring and logging to ensure reliability and style for effectiveness and scalability. This includes an evergrowing trend depending on Infrastructure because Code and a focus about modularizing pieces that can be used again and easily scaled.
The sector is moving towards a “unbundling” of information infrastructure like the way that full-stack web development matured via HTML, CSS and JS to separate frameworks for every single function type. This is evidenced by a a comprehensive portfolio of new tooling filling in various niches like queuing program, serverless tools and data analytics platforms.